What Is Social Anxiety and How Can Support Groups Help?

Social anxiety disorder involves intense fear of social situations, leading to avoidance and distress. A support group can be helpful for social anxiety disorder, according to Cleveland Clinic. These groups reduce feelings of loneliness and social isolation caused by the condition.

Support groups for social anxiety provide opportunities for practicing social skills, peer support, and learning from others with similar experiences. You can reduce anxiety by joining these groups. They help you meet others who understand and share ideas for managing social anxiety disorder. Relationships affected by social anxiety can also improve.

Social anxiety support groups can be found online and in-person. Local support groups for social anxiety offer a safe space for sharing experiences and practicing social skills. They provide emotional support and validation, allowing members to share stories and coping techniques among sufferers.

How Do Online Social Anxiety Support Groups Work?

Online social anxiety support groups function as virtual environments where you connect with others. They offer various formats, including video conference meetings, discussion forums, and chat rooms. You can access these groups through forums, chatrooms, mobile apps, and video conference meetings.

These groups provide peer support, allowing you to share challenges with others experiencing similar problems. They offer encouragement and reduce feelings of isolation. You can share stories and coping techniques among sufferers, which helps in practicing social skills and learning from others. For example, the Social Anxiety Support Forum is an online community dedicated to people with social anxiety.

Online social anxiety support groups are a good choice if you want to remain anonymous or cannot attend in-person meetings. They provide a supportive online community. You might consider online support groups and discussion forums as supplementary support for managing social anxiety.

Free vs Paid Support Groups

Free and paid social anxiety support groups online differ mainly in their structure and available resources. Free groups often provide peer-led discussions and community connection, which can be a good starting point for many. Paid options, however, frequently offer more structured programs, professional facilitation, or access to additional therapeutic tools. For someone seeking consistent, professionally guided support, a paid group might be a better fit, while free groups are ideal for those prioritizing accessibility and peer interaction. Ultimately, your choice depends on the level of support you need and what you are comfortable investing.

Anonymous and Safe Group Options

Many social anxiety support groups online offer options for anonymity and safety. These groups often allow you to use a pseudonym or only your first name to protect your identity. Platforms typically implement privacy settings and moderation to ensure a safe environment for sharing personal experiences.

What Technology Is Needed to Participate in Online Groups?+

To join social anxiety support groups online, you'll need some basic tech. You'll need a stable internet connection. A computer, tablet, or smartphone works well. You'll also want a working microphone and usually a webcam so others can see you. Many groups use secure video conferencing platforms, like Zoom. Some may require you to install specific apps. Make sure your device has enough memory for these tools. Getting familiar with the platform before your first session helps a lot.

How Often Do Online Social Anxiety Support Groups Meet?+

Online social anxiety support groups meet on different schedules. Many groups hold sessions weekly. You'll also find options that meet biweekly or monthly. Some adult groups even run weekly for 90 minutes over 10 to 12 weeks. Other online communities might have more flexible, "as needed" meetings. This variety helps you find a consistent schedule that works best for your routine.
